Welcome to Kahrtalk jkalantzis....You came to the right place...Pleanty of nice folks here with a wealth of information if you need it....DO read the manual as you will learn something, Your Kahr is a great little pistol and will shoot well but the part about the 200 round break in is a must as is the loading from a full magazine being done from the slide stop and not by hand... I have a CW40 and can slingshot the first round now but every now and then it will jam....The slingshot has to be very abrupt, almost violent as anything less will cause a first round jam...Your gun is smaller and is more prone to doing this....Enjoy her my friend and let us all know how it goes....:cool:
